The Lisbon Metropolitan Orchestra is preparing to delight music and science lovers with a very special concert. Under the baton of Maestro Cláudio Ferreira, the highlight will be the adaptation for classical orchestra of Gustav Holst’s iconic work ‘The Planets, Op. 32’. But that’s not all: the public will also have the privilege of listening to a lecture by writer Gonçalo M. Tavares, who will explore the theme of the cosmos.
